EDITORS COMMENTS
This print showcases the iconic Queen Victoria, who reigned over England during the 19th century. The hand-colored woodcut beautifully captures her regal presence and timeless elegance. As one of the most influential monarchs in British history, Queen Victoria's image represents a significant era of European royalty. Adorned with her majestic crown, this vintage portrait exudes a sense of heritage and tradition that is deeply rooted in Great Britain's rich history. Her poised demeanor reflects the strength and grace she possessed as a female ruler in a male-dominated society. Queen Victoria's reign marked an important period for the United Kingdom, as it expanded its influence across the globe. Notably, she was also proclaimed Empress of India during this time, further solidifying her status as an influential figure on both national and international stages. The artistry behind this illustration highlights the craftsmanship prevalent during the 1800s. Its intricate details capture every nuance of Queen Victoria's features while adding depth to her royal attire. This print serves as a reminder of Queen Victoria's lasting impact on British culture and Europe as a whole. It invites us to delve into history and appreciate the legacy left by this remarkable woman who shaped an entire era through her leadership and determination.
